7 Wine & Candy Pairings You Need to Try

October 25, 2023

Halloween is nigh! Raid the kids’ treat bags and try these seven spooky wine and candy pairings! —Vita Daily

M&M’s + Liquidity 2020 Pinot Noir: Plush red fruits and velvety tannins are complimented by juicy acidity and fresh minerality. With its balanced acidity and red fruit notes, Liquidity Estate Pinot Noir harmonizes with the sweetness of M&M’s, creating a balance and enjoyable pairing that enhances the flavours of both the wine and chocolate.

Snickers + Road 13 John Oliver Selection 2020 Syrah: This Syrah has a textured palate layered with lush blue fruit, a vibrant crip acidity, mocha and glossy oak which allow for an incredible pairing with Snickers. The mocha and oak flavours of the wine complement the candy’s nougat and caramel, creating a enjoyable pairing.

Butterfingers + CedarCreek Estate Winery 2021 Chardonnay: CedarCreek Estate Winery Chardonnay offers lime, lemon, mineral and peach on the nose, with fresh acidity and a round weighty palate. The buttery layers inside Butterfingers will melt in your mouth with every sip of Chardonnay.

Dark Chocolate + Santa Julia Reserva Malbec: Santa Julia Reserva Malbec will pair well with dark chocolate. The bold flavours of ripe black plum with notes of black currant, honey, coffee and citrus compliment the richness of dark chocolate.

Candy Corn + Mionetto Prosecco: Mionetto Prosecco offers vivid fruit character, making it a great pairing for candy corn. On the palate the notes of Asian pear, honey and lees. This clean and versatile Prosecco will help mellow the sweetness of candy corn.

BBQ Chips + 7 Deadly Zins Old Vine Zinfandel: On the palate 7 Deadly Zins shows flavours of dark fruits, currants and toffee, through a lingering spice-touched finish. It pairs well with barbeque and spicy foods, which makes BBQ chips a strong pairing.

Fruity Candies + Graffigna Pinot Grigio: This fresh and crisp Pinot Grigio offers flavours of citrus, mushrooms and herbs. Graffigna Pinot Grigio will pair well with your favourite fruit candies, both sweet and sour.
